Gregoria Lost Dramatically in the Final

Jakarta

Gregoria Mariska Tunjung had to settle for being runner-up Swiss Open 2024 after losing to Carolina Marin. Gregoria lost even though he got match point first.

In the final match of the 2024 Swiss Open in St. Jakobshalle, Basel, Sunday (24/3/2024) evening WIB, Gregoria went through a tight duel for three games against Marin. After fighting for 1 hour 21 minutes, Gregoria lost 19-21, 21-13, 20-22 to the three-time world champion.

Gregoria took the lead at the start of the first game. He led 10-6 and entered the interval with an 11-9 lead.

Marin was able to catch up and turn ahead. However, Gregoria, who was behind 14-18, was able to equalize by winning four points in a row.

Marin’s sharp attacks overwhelmed Gregoria. Gregoria ultimately lost the first game 19-21 after his cross shot went wide.

Gregoria started the second game well and was ahead 11-8 at the interval. Through accurate ball placements, Gregoria earned points.

Gregoria made Marin fall and fall several times chasing the ball. He finally won the second game 21-13 to force a rubber game.

In the deciding game, Gregoria won seven points in a row to lead 10-4 over Marin. Through a cross ball that Marin failed to return, Gregoria entered the interval with an 11-6 lead.

After the interval, Gregoria actually lost the lead after Marin won six points in a row to take the lead. Since then, Gregoria and Marin continued to chase the points until they drew 19-19.

Gregoria managed to reach match point first, but was thwarted by Marin. In the setting match, Gregoria made a mistake in returning Marin’s serve and gave her opponent match point. Gregoria ultimately lost 20-22 to Marin.
